justinjohnsenFirst time  Sucess!
Date Climbed: Aug 11, 2007

First time up, with three Outdoors Club friends. A scorcher down below, but cool and windy from Icehouse Saddle to the peak. Trail in excellent condition. No water past Columbine Spring, at Icehouse Canyon's switchbacks. Intrigued by the copper mine on Bighorn Peak's east face. Less haze than most days this summer, meaning good views. Drought damage apparent on some of the pines, especially on the peak. Saw two rattlesnakes above Icehouse Saddle, beauties, a real treat.
